Port Huron's air quality benefits from Lake Huron's consistent lake winds providing maritime ventilation along the Michigan-Ontario border at the St. Clair River. Vehicle emissions from I-94 and the surrounding manufacturing and port operations contribute local sources, while the St. Clair River's cross-border industrial corridor from Sarnia Ontario contributes chemical and petrochemical background emissions under southerly wind conditions throughout the year.

When is air pollution at its worst in Port Huron?

Like most US cities, Port Huron sees air quality shift from season to season, as between summer ozone and occasional winter inversions, spring and fall are the year's cleanest stretch; by contrast, summer heat waves are the main driver of poor air quality, as ozone builds under stagnant, humid conditions. Lake-effect winds can help clear the air on many days near the Great Lakes shoreline.

Are air quality levels in Port Huron based on measurements or forecasts?

It is forecasts derived by downscaling forecasts provided by EU’s Copernicus Atmosphere Monitoring Service (CAMS) by taking into account local conditions such as traffic patterns. CAMS bases its forecast on satellite measurements of particles and chemical compounds in the atmosphere.
